## Account Recovery — Trailnote Offline Mode

When a surveyor's Trailnote app has been offline for 30+ days, their local credentials expire and sync refuses to resume. Don't make them wipe the device — all their unsynced field data lives there! Instead, open the support console, pick "Offline Reinstate," and enter their handle. The console will ask for the support team's shared recovery passphrase before issuing a reinstatement token. Use the one below.

unlock words, bagaf-fajeg: zorael-kelax-fraath-quenix-eliok-sileth-aldmir-wenir-druiel

### v7.1 — Changed defaults

The Oakmere exam-proctoring queue now defaults to priority scheduling instead of strict FIFO. Sessions flagged for live review jump ahead of routine recordings, which previously caused review backlogs during peak exam windows. Retry limits and visibility timeouts were also adjusted. Contractors picking up queue work should assume these new defaults everywhere; the full set now shipped is listed below.

service settings:
PRAWYN_PIN=9848
PRAWYN_METRICS_HOST=metrics.prawyn.lumicworks.corp
PRAWYN_LOG_LEVEL=warn
PRAWYN_TENANT=pelius

Second-Source Supplier Search (Managers Only)

Status: active. Primary supplier Korvane Metals remains sole source for the VX-9 housings. Risk: single-point failure, rising lead times. Shortlist: Ettenbrook Castings, Palefort Alloys, and Rivago Works. Ettenbrook passed initial quality audit; Palefort pending. Target: qualified second source by end of Q2. Budget impact modest; tooling duplication is the main cost. Decision memo due at the next steering session. Incoming director should read the confidential note below first.

internal memo for yahag-tahog: The pricing group signed off on a budget of $152.8 million for Project Soriel.

## Crumbline Environments: Order Cutoff Rule

This page explains how the Crumbline ordering service enforces the daily bakery cutoff across environments. Orders placed after the cutoff roll to the next baking day; same-day exceptions require a supervisor override in the admin panel. Staging uses a later cutoff so QA can test evening flows, which sometimes confuses support tickets — always check the environment first. The cutoff settings for each environment are listed below.

service settings:
[casax]
port = 6379
team = rusir
host = casax.zemvarhq.corp
region = outer-4
access_code = ac_9808ce
timeout_ms = 1500